Understanding the Role of a Window Doctor
A window doctor is a professional who specializes in the repair, maintenance, and replacement of windows. They can deal with different problems, including drafty windows, broken panes, seal failures, and hardware breakdowns. Quality window physicians are skilled in various types of windows, including:
Single-hung windowsDouble-hung windowsMoving windowsBay and bow windowsCasement windows
Having a professional window doctor on hand can help extend the life expectancy of your windows and improve energy effectiveness in your house.

Picking the right window doctor is necessary for achieving the desired outcomes. Here are some essential elements to consider:
1. Experience
Try to find a window doctor with a proven performance history in window repair and replacement. Ask about the number of years they have actually stayed in business and the kinds of jobs they usually handle.
2. Licensing and Insurance
Make sure that the window doctor holds the necessary licenses to operate in your location and carries insurance coverage to safeguard versus potential damages during the repair or installation process.
3. Referrals and Reviews
Request for referrals and read evaluations from previous customers. This can supply insights into the quality of their work and their professionalism.

What types of windows can a quality window doctor repair?
A quality Quick Window Repair doctor can typically repair various window types, consisting of single-hung, double-hung, casement, and sliding windows, to name a few.
2. How do I understand when it’s time to replace my windows?
Indications that it may be time to change your windows include substantial drafts, condensation in between panes, and noticeable physical damage or decay.
3. How frequently should I have my windows inspected?
It’s suggested to have your windows inspected a minimum of as soon as a year to capture any prospective problems early.
4. Can window medical professionals replace just part of a window?
Frequently, Window Doctor Near Me physicians can change specific parts like glass panes or hardware, however this will depend on the severity and type of damage.
5. How can I improve the energy performance of my windows?
Improving energy efficiency can be attained through proper sealing, installing double or triple-pane glass, and adding window treatments like shades or films.
